What Is A Laminar Flow Hood?

A Laminar Flow Hood is a highly specialized workstation designed to create an ultra-clean environment. It achieves this by passing air through a HEPA (High-Efficiency Particulate Air) filter and then directing it in a uniform, unidirectional, and non-turbulent (laminar) flow across the work surface. This constant flow effectively sweeps away airborne contaminants, such as dust, microorganisms, and particles, preventing them from settling on sensitive materials or samples. The result is a workspace that significantly minimizes the risk of cross-contamination and ensures product or sample integrity.

The primary function of a laminar flow hood is to protect both the product being manipulated and the user from potential contamination. By creating a sterile or highly controlled atmosphere, it is indispensable in a variety of critical laboratory and healthcare settings.

  • Sterile Product Preparation: Essential for compounding sterile medications, intravenous solutions, and chemotherapy drugs in hospital pharmacies, ensuring patient safety and preventing infections.
  • Cell Culture and Biological Research: Widely used in research laboratories to maintain aseptic conditions for growing cell cultures, performing molecular biology experiments, and working with sensitive biological materials.
  • Microbiology and Diagnostic Testing: Critical for performing diagnostic tests, culturing microorganisms, and ensuring accurate and reliable results by preventing external contamination of samples.
  • Pharmaceutical Manufacturing: Utilized in the manufacturing of pharmaceutical products to maintain sterile environments for critical processes like filling, sealing, and packaging, adhering to stringent regulatory standards.

How Much Is A Laminar Flow Hood In Guinea?

The cost of a laminar flow hood in Guinea can vary significantly based on several factors, including the type of hood (horizontal, vertical, biological safety cabinet), its size and specifications, brand reputation, the supplier, and any additional features or certifications required. While specific pricing is best obtained through direct quotes, you can expect a broad range in Guinea Francs (GNF).

For a basic horizontal or vertical laminar flow hood suitable for general laboratory applications, prices might start in the range of 15,000,000 GNF to 30,000,000 GNF. These units typically offer good protection for samples and product but may have simpler filtration systems or fewer advanced safety features compared to higher-end models.

More advanced or specialized units, such as Class II Biological Safety Cabinets (BSCs) that offer personnel, product, and environmental protection, will command a higher price. These could range from 30,000,000 GNF to 70,000,000 GNF or even more, depending on the level of containment, airflow patterns, and sophisticated monitoring systems.

Factors that can influence the final price include:

  • Brand and manufacturer reputation (established international brands often come at a premium).
  • Level of filtration (HEPA filters are standard, but specific efficiencies and pre-filters can affect cost).
  • Size and internal working space dimensions.
  • Construction materials and build quality.
  • Warranty and after-sales service packages.
  • Customization options or specific regulatory compliance needs.
  • Import duties, taxes, and shipping costs to Guinea.
